General Description
2-(4,7-DIMETHOXY-1H-INDOL-3-YL)-ETHYLAMINE is a chemical compound with a molecular structure that contains a central indole ring with two methoxy groups at positions 4 and 7, and an ethylamine moiety attached at the 3-position. 2-(4,7-DIMETHOXY-1H-INDOL-3-YL)-ETHYLAMINE is classified as a tryptamine derivative and is often found in various psychoactive plants and fungi. It has been studied for its potential pharmacological effects, including its interaction with serotonin receptors and its potential as a hallucinogenic or psychedelic substance. Additionally, this compound has been investigated for its potential therapeutic applications, including its use in the treatment of certain neurological and psychiatric disorders.
Check Digit Verification of cas no
The CAS Registry Mumber 91557-43-6 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 9,1,5,5 and 7 respectively; the second part has 2 digits, 4 and 3 respectively.
Calculate Digit Verification of CAS Registry Number 91557-43:
(7*9)+(6*1)+(5*5)+(4*5)+(3*7)+(2*4)+(1*3)=146
146 % 10 = 6
So 91557-43-6 is a valid CAS Registry Number.
